Name: LI-2200 Rigid Tile
Database: NASA Ames Thermal Protection Materials
Category: Silicon-Based Reusable Composites: Rigid Ceramic Tiles
Composition: 100% SiO2
Manufacturer: United Space Alliance (USA)
Technical Readiness Level: 9
Last Modified: 2001-10-01

Description:

  • LI-2200 is a relatively high density (~22 lbs/cu.ft.) and thermal conductivity fibrous insulation material with higher strength than the LI-900 baselined for use on all the shuttle orbiters. It is currently flying on all orbiters, but to a very limited extent due to itsÕ weight. It was originally developed to provide an enhanced strength RSI tile relative to LI-900.
